What is a Rugged PC?

A rugged PC is a computer specifically designed to operate reliably in harsh usage conditions and environments such as wet or dusty conditions, strong vibrations, dust/water, and extreme temperatures. It is an integrated solution that combines both a display and a computing unit, making it an all-in-one computer.

The essential design philosophy of rugged PCs is to provide a controlled environment for the mounted electronics.

To guarantee the performance in harsh environments, rugged PCs are engineered with the addition of liquid cooling and heat sinks, reduction of cabling, and rugged materials. They are made with electronic components as these components have the capability to withstand higher and lower operating temperatures than typical commercial components.

Rugged PCs are integrated with fully sealed keyboards to defend against intrusion by liquids or dust, and scratch-resistant screens that are readable in direct sunlight. These are ideal for various uses such as outdoor kiosks, transportation scheduling, information display systems, multimedia advertising, and industrial control etc.

When can we use Rugged PC?

Rugged PC is used in various industries such as manufacturing, chemical industries, and logistics & transportation etc. They can be operated in wet/dusty, strong vibrations, dust/water, and extreme temperatures.

Manufacturing: A technician can repair overhead crane using rugged PC. In this case, a technician may not carry design sheet with him but he can use rugged PC to carry out his work (Where he can find his design on PC). And since it is rugged, there is no worry about damaging the device.

Chemical Industries: When used in chemical industries, rugged PC’s hardware and software components can sustain a chemical spill or smoke and even high temperatures.

Logistics & Transportation: Rugged PCs are used to monitor logistics & transportation operations while traveling through different geographies where there can be extreme dust, weather, heat, water, and tough terrain. In such cases, preferring rugged PCs is a good option.
